Santa Ana school district employee arrested for reportedly offering teens drugs

A 30-year-old employee with the Santa Ana Unified School District is behind bars accused of trying to lure a couple of teenage girls into his vehicle by offering them drugs.

Garden Grove police say Julio Lugo Torres, a resident of Garden Grove, approached the two girls in the parking lot of a business in the area of Fairview Street and Trask Avenue on Jan. 25, 2019 while driving a white Ford Explorer to ask them for directions to where he could purchase drugs.

Police say Torres then "attempted to coerce the victims into his vehicle by providing drugs to them."

The girls declined and took a photo of Torres' car before running away, according to authorities who say the teens' information to police led to Torres being arrested and booked into Orange County Jail.

During the investigation, Garden Grove police learned that Torres was employed by the Santa Ana Unified School District. Investigators are now looking for additional victims or witnesses.
